What Exactly is "Celebrity Net Worth"?

At its core, celebrity net worth is an estimate of an individual’s total assets minus their total liabilities. Sounds simple, right? For celebrities, however, “assets” can range from their private jets and sprawling mansions to their brand endorsements, intellectual property rights, and investments in various companies. “Liabilities” include mortgages, loans, and, perhaps most significantly, taxes.

It’s a snapshot, often publicly estimated, of their financial standing.

The Many Sources of Celebrity Wealth

The days of simply earning big from a single blockbuster movie are long gone. Today’s celebrities diversify their portfolios like savvy entrepreneurs.

Traditional Entertainment

Film & Television: Upfront salaries, backend deals, and residuals. Music: Album sales, streaming royalties, touring, merchandise. Sports: Salaries, prize money, bonuses. Literature & Art: Book deals, art sales.

Endorsements & Brand Deals

This is often where the real money lies. Celebrities lend their image and influence to brands for hefty fees. Think fashion lines, perfume deals, beverage endorsements, and luxury goods partnerships.

Entrepreneurship & Investments

Many famous individuals are astute business people: Owning production companies or record labels. Investing in tech startups, real estate, or private equity. Launching their own lifestyle brands, cosmetics lines, or food ventures.

Social Media & Digital Content

The digital age has opened new income streams:
Sponsored posts on Instagram, TikTok, or YouTube. Creating exclusive content for subscription platforms. Building massive online communities that can be monetized.

The "Shocking Truths" Behind Celebrity Net Worth

Now for the revealing part. Those eye-popping figures often come with caveats.

It's Often an Estimate

Reputable sources calculate celebrity net worth using public data, financial filings (where available), real estate records, and industry insights. However, without direct access to private financial records, these numbers are educated guesses, not always precise. Different sources can publish vastly different figures for the same individual.

Taxes & Expenses are Huge

High income means high taxes. Celebrities often pay substantial amounts in income tax, property tax, and sales tax. Beyond taxes, their lavish lifestyles come with enormous overheads: Teams of agents, managers, publicists, lawyers. Security details, personal assistants, chefs. Maintenance for multiple luxury homes, private jets, and yachts. Travel expenses, elaborate wardrobes, and designer goods.

A $100 million earning year doesn’t mean $100 million in the bank.

Not All Wealth is Liquid

A significant portion of a celebrity's wealth might be tied up in assets that aren't easily converted to cash. This could include: Real estate portfolios. Equity in their own companies. Art collections, luxury vehicles, or other collectibles. Investment portfolios that aren't meant to be liquidated quickly.

From Rags to Riches (and Sometimes Back Again)

While many stories are about meteoric rises, there are also tales of financial downfall. Poor investments, extravagant spending, legal troubles, and a decline in career relevance can all significantly impact a celebrity net worth. Financial management is crucial, even for the super-rich.
